Output 5abba1b8109903d1df4fbd6c1fa73c0c6031ff3d1dae458313ff1e447c71ec4c:4

value
8901125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 827cf21dbbeaa7fc55b48e89b1374436040ce7e9 OP_EQUAL
address
3DaySsAbmRMyCfPQUoyDRJdxdSpfWeEqZ4
transaction
5abba1b8109903d1df4fbd6c1fa73c0c6031ff3d1dae458313ff1e447c71ec4c
confirmations
457062
spent
true